WebBBC 4’s The Great War Interviews A collection of 13 interviews filmed in the 1960s for the landmark BBC series The Great War (1964). In these poignant B&W interviews, veterans and civilians, by then already into their late 60’s, share memories of what it was really like to experience at first hand the grim reality of this most brutal of conflicts. To mark the 100 th anniversary of Armistice Day, the BBC delved into its archives to produce a moving documentary called I Was There: The Great War Interviews.
